How can I find good job locations after completing my master's abroad in UK/Australia for a PhD?
To find good job locations after your master's abroad, focus on countries with strong post-study work visa (PSW) options and active job markets for international graduates.
- Canada: Offers up to 3 years on a Post-Graduation Work Permit (PGWP); strong demand in tech, healthcare, and engineering.
- Australia: Temporary Graduate Visa allows 2-4 years of work; robust opportunities in healthcare, IT, and engineering.
- UK: Graduate Route visa grants up to 2 years (3 for PhD) to work; diverse roles in finance, tech, and creative sectors.
- Germany: 18-month Job Seeker Visa; good for STEM fields.
- US: Optional Practical Training (OPT) gives up to 12 months (STEM extension possible); dynamic job market.
